INDONESIAN COAL PRICE REFERENCE HITS 74 MONTHS HIGH OF $104.65 A TON
COALspotCOALspot.com: HBA keeps rising. According to latest ministerial decree No.1892 K/30/MEM/2018 dated 2 July 2018, the Indonesian Coal Price Reference (HBA) up 8.32 per cent in July 2018 compared to June HBA.
 
The benchmark price of Indonesian thermal coal has increased US$ 8.04 per ton month on month to $ 104.65 per ton for July 2018 delivery for exports as well domestic end-users except Indonesian power producers. The Minister of Energy and Mineral Resources Republic Indonesia had declared July HBA at US$ 104.65 per ton for 6322 GAR power plant coal by issuing a ministerial decree 1892 K/30/MEM/2018 dated 2 July 2018.

The Ministry of Energy and Mineral Resources Republic Indonesia has increased the monthly Indonesian thermal coal price reference for July 2018 delivery meantime, the July 2018 HBA was 32.55% higher the comparable period in 2017.
 
Indonesia has capped the price of thermal coal for domestic power stations at $70 per ton (basis 6322 GAR Coal) if HBA is equal to or higher than US$ 70 per ton until December 2019 form 12 March 2018, in new rule was issued on 9 March 2018 (MEMR Ministerial decree 1395K/30/MEM/2018) and 1410 K/30/MEM/2018 dated 12 March 2018. However the HBA drops below $70 per ton, the domestic thermal coal price for power stations will revert to HBA. This special price for power plants is applicable for maximum100 million tons of coal per year.
 
US$ 70 price is based on coal as the same specification as in the Indonesian Coal Benchmark Price (HBA). Domestic Power producers used to buy 4200 to 5000 GAR coal where’s US$ 70 per ton was based on 6322 GAR coal.
 
An increase or decrease in four international coal indices such as Indonesia Coal Index (ICI), Platts-5900, Newcastle Export Index (NEX) and Global coal Newcastle Index (GCNC) will cause an increase or decrease in Indonesian coal price reference every month, as HBA is linked to those international coal indices. The coal price reference in Indonesia was established to fulfill the requirement of mining Law 04/2009 and ministerial decree No.17/2010. In addition to that, it aims to increase government revenue from royalties from coal producers.
 
The declared Indonesia thermal coal reference price (or called HBA) for February 2016 was the lowest in 115 months or since launching of HBA by the government of Indonesia. The royalties and taxes will be calculated based on this declared HPB. Interestingly, the highest monthly average price occurred in February 2011, while the lowest coal price also occurred in February 2016. The July 2018, HBA is 105.52% higher than the February 2016 price and 17.63% lower than the February 2011 price.
 
Indonesian coal benchmark price for July 2018 was calculated based on calorific value of 6,322 kcal/kg (GAR), stated to be using a formula based on the June 2018 index average of ICI-1 (Indonesia Coal Index) 25%, Platts-5900 25%, NEX (Newcastle Export Index) 25%, and GC (globalCoal Index) 25% and its was calculated considering coal with GCV (GAR) 6,322 kcal/kg, Total Moisture (arb) 8.00%, Total Sulphur 0.8% (arb), Ash Content 15 % (arb) and  delivery free on Board (FOB) Vessel basis and apply to spot contract, delivery between 1 – 31 July 2018 or until publish an new HBA.
 
The highest benchmark price was declared by the Ministry of Energy & Mineral Resources of Indonesia in February 2011, and this month’s declared price is around US$ 22.40 a ton or 17.63% lower compared to Feb’ 11 benchmark price. In the meantime, this month’s declared price was around US$53.73 a ton or 105.52% higher compared to Feb’ 16 benchmark price, which was the lowest price ever declared by DGoMC.
 
The government of Indonesia was publishing a monthly coal price reference (HBA & HPB) since February 2009 to be used by coal producers for all spot and term contracts.
 
However, the official implementation of HBA was commenced since September 2011 and according to government regulation, the coal benchmark price must be used by the holders of production operation IUPs, special production operation IUP's, and CCoWs as a reference in determining the coal selling price for a particular period.
 
The declared HBA in this month is valid for the spot price (loading on or before 31 July 2018 or until issuing an new HBA), while (as per previous HBA note) as for term price (up to 12 months’ supply), the average reference price (HPB) of the previous three months will be used to determine the selling price. (50% of latest month's HPB (this month) 30% one-month prior HPB and 20% of two-month prior HPB).
 
The government used to declare the price marker for eight brands of Indonesia's coal, which were most commonly traded in the market. Those eight brands act as the benchmark and used to calculate other 69 coal types with a quality similar to the coal price markers.
